Importance of Pollinators for Plant Health

Pollinators are the unsung heroes behind plant reproduction. These tiny creatures, including bees, butterflies, and hummingbirds, play a vital role in transferring pollen from one plant to another, allowing plants to reproduce and set seed. Without pollinators, many plants would be unable to produce fruit or seeds, ultimately impacting their overall health.

Native Plants that Attract Pollinators

When it comes to creating a pollinator-friendly oasis indoors, selecting native plants that naturally attract these beneficial creatures is crucial. Let’s explore some of the most effective options for your misting indoor garden.

Black-eyed Susan (Rudbeckia hirta) is an excellent choice, boasting bright yellow petals and dark centers that are irresistible to bees and butterflies. This perennial grows up to 3 feet tall with a spread of 2 feet, requiring full sun to partial shade and well-drained soil. To care for Black-eyed Susans, water them regularly but avoid overwatering.

Bee Balm (Monarda didyma) is another pollinator magnet, featuring red, pink, or purple flowers that are shaped like lips. This fragrant herb grows 2-3 feet tall with a spread of 1-2 feet, requiring moist soil and partial shade to full sun. To keep Bee Balm thriving, prune it back after blooming to encourage new growth.

Lavender (Lavandula spp.) is also a popular choice for pollinator-friendly gardens, producing spikes of purple flowers that are rich in nectar. This low-maintenance shrub grows 1-2 feet tall with a spread of 1 foot, requiring well-drained soil and full sun to partial shade.

Materials Needed for a Simple Misting System

When it comes to setting up a misting system for your indoor pollinator-friendly plants, you’ll need some basic materials to get started. Don’t worry, these are likely items you already have on hand or can easily acquire.

First and foremost, you’ll need tubing that’s specifically designed for irrigation systems. This type of tubing is usually made from durable materials like PVC or polyethylene, which can withstand the water pressure without bursting. For a simple misting system, 1/4 inch or 1/2 inch tubing will suffice. You can find this at most gardening stores or online.

Next up are the nozzles themselves. These are responsible for dispersing the fine mist that your plants love. Look for adjustable nozzles that allow you to customize the spray pattern and droplet size to suit your specific needs. Some popular types of nozzles include fan sprays, atomizing sprayers, and foggers.

Another crucial component is a timer or controller. This ensures that your misting system operates on a regular schedule, giving your plants a consistent supply of moisture without wasting water. You can choose between manual timers, digital controllers, or even smartphone app-controlled systems. Whichever you select, make sure it’s compatible with your tubing and nozzles.

To complete the setup, you’ll need some fittings to connect the tubing and nozzles together securely. These usually come in the form of couplings, elbows, or tees. Be sure to choose ones that match your tubing type and size for a leak-free installation.

As you assemble the system, keep an eye on the water pressure gauge to ensure it’s within safe operating limits (usually around 30-40 PSI). Finally, don’t forget to install a shut-off valve near the reservoir to prevent accidental overwatering or leaks. Assembly and Maintenance Tips

To ensure your DIY misting system runs smoothly and effectively, it’s essential to follow these assembly and maintenance steps.

When assembling your system, start by attaching the water reservoir to a stable surface. Connect the pump to the reservoir, making sure all connections are secure and watertight. Next, attach the tubing to the pump, running it through any additional components like filters or valves. Finally, connect the nozzle or misting head to the end of the tubing.

Regular maintenance is crucial for optimal performance. Check your system regularly for signs of wear or clogging, such as reduced water flow or increased pressure. Clean or replace any affected parts to prevent damage. Additionally, change the water in the reservoir every 1-2 weeks to prevent bacterial growth and maintain water quality. Consider also monitoring the pH level of your water and adjusting it according to the specific needs of your plants.

Pest Control Methods that Harm Fewer Pollinators

When it comes to maintaining healthy pollinator-friendly plants indoors, it’s essential to consider integrated pest management (IPM) methods that minimize harm to these vital creatures. IPM approaches combine physical, cultural, biological, and chemical controls to manage pests while avoiding broad-spectrum pesticides.

To protect your pollinators, avoid using pyrethrin-based sprays, which can be toxic to bees and other beneficial insects. Instead, opt for neem oil or insecticidal soap, which are gentler on pollinators but still effective against common indoor pests like spider mites and mealybugs.

When choosing pest control methods, consider the life stage of your plants and the specific pest you’re trying to eliminate. For example, if you have aphid infestations on your flowering plants, use sticky traps or introduce natural predators like ladybugs to control populations. Similarly, for fungal diseases, use a fungicidal soap solution specifically designed for indoor use.

Remember that prevention is key: ensure good air circulation, maintain optimal temperature and humidity levels, and inspect your plants regularly to catch any issues before they become severe. Troubleshooting Mist System Issues

Misting systems can be finicky, and issues with leaks or inadequate coverage are common problems many gardeners face. Don’t worry; troubleshooting these issues is often a simple matter of identifying the root cause and making a few adjustments.

Firstly, let’s start with leaky pipes or hoses. A dripping misting system not only wastes water but also attracts pests like ants and aphids to your plants. To identify a leak, inspect your setup carefully, looking for signs of moisture or drips around connections, valves, or tubes. If you find a leak, tighten any loose connections, replace damaged or worn-out parts, and ensure all tubing is securely attached.

Another issue you might encounter is inadequate coverage. This can be due to various factors such as low water pressure, clogged nozzles, or an insufficient number of misting points. To resolve this problem, start by checking your system’s water pressure; if it’s too low, consider installing a pump or increasing the flow rate. Also, clean and inspect the nozzles regularly, replacing them if necessary.

To maintain optimal performance, regular checks are essential. Schedule a weekly inspection of your misting setup to identify any potential issues before they become major problems. This includes monitoring water pressure, nozzle cleanliness, and tube integrity.
